eGOVERNMENT HAS EVOLVED from websites to delivering early “core” online services like driver’s license renewals to now breaking new ground in transactional services, social media, mobility and security. It has morphed into something broader, more pervasive and far more flexible than the original concept — and it continues to evolve based on rapidly changing citizen and business needs.
eGovernment today is fundamentally about delivering citizen and business services securely — to any mobile device — and making these services more accessible to the people who need them. There are many “behind the scenes” dimensions that make eGovernment operate efficiently and successfully — but it all starts with the three foundational elements of security, mobility and transactional services.
Understanding these three key tenets of eGovernment will form a powerful and robust framework to lead government agencies confidently into the future.
